What Is Strontium Nitrate Used For? Key Roles in Pyrotechnics and Signal Applications

A common question in chemical and industrial fields is what is strontium nitrate used for. Strontium nitrate is best known for its ability to produce a bright red flame, making it an essential compound in pyrotechnics and signaling systems.

This article explains how strontium nitrate works, why it is used in fireworks, and its importance in visual signaling applications.

What Is Strontium Nitrate?

Strontium nitrate is an inorganic salt composed of strontium and nitrate ions. It appears as a white crystalline powder and is:

Highly soluble in water

Chemically stable under normal conditions

A strong oxidizing agent

These properties make it ideal for controlled combustion and color production.

What Is Strontium Nitrate Used For in Pyrotechnics?

1. Producing Red Flame Color

The most well-known answer to what is strontium nitrate used for is its role as a red colorant in fireworks.

When heated, strontium ions emit a deep red light, which is:

Bright

Consistent

Easily distinguishable in the sky

This makes strontium nitrate essential in:

Fireworks displays

Flares

Signal lights

2. Acting as an Oxidizer

Strontium nitrate also functions as an oxidizer, supplying oxygen to fuel materials during combustion.

This dual role:

Enhances flame intensity

Ensures stable ignition

Improves burn consistency

3. Military and Emergency Signaling

Because of its reliable red flame, strontium nitrate is used in:

Distress flares

Military signal devices

Aviation and maritime signaling systems

Red signals are universally recognized, making strontium nitrate critical in safety applications.

Advantages in Pyrotechnic Formulations

Produces vivid red color

Stable during storage

Compatible with other pyrotechnic chemicals

Performs well under varied conditions

Safety and Handling Notes

As an oxidizing compound:

Store away from flammable materials

Avoid contamination with organic substances

Follow proper handling and transportation regulations

Conclusion

So, what is strontium nitrate used for in its most common application? It is a key ingredient in fireworks, flares, and signaling devices, valued for its brilliant red flame and reliable oxidizing properties.
